#1e1d96 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1e1d96 is composed of 11.8% red, 11.4% green and 58.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 80% cyan, 80.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 41.2% black. It has a hue angle of 240.5 degrees, a saturation of 67.6% and a lightness of 35.1%. #1e1d96 color hex could be obtained by blending #3c3aff with #00002d. Closest websafe color is: #333399.

#1e1d96 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#1e1d96 has RGB values of R:30, G:29, B:150 and CMYK values of C:0.8, M:0.81, Y:0, K:0.41. Its decimal value is 1973654.
